Ewon by HMS Networks NB1007-C is a communication gateway designed for both DIN rail or wall mounting, facilitating Ethernet to Netbiter Argos IIoT platform connectivity. It features an LED indicator for operational status and supports SNMP for network management. The gateway offers multiple connection options, including 2 x RJ45 connectors for 10/100Mbit/s Ethernet (1 x WAN and 1 x LAN), 2 x 3-pin connectors for serial connections supporting up to 115.2kbit/s (1 x RS-232 and 1 x RS-485), and 1 x USB micro B connector. Part of the Netbiter EC300 series, it measures H27mm x W135mm x D92mm and has an IP20 degree of protection. The NB1007-C operates on a supply voltage of 9-32Vdc (with 12Vdc / 24Vdc nominal) and is encased in a metal housing. It supports various communication protocols including Ethernet, Modbus, Modbus RTU, Modbus TCP, RS-232, and RS-485. Power consumption is rated at 2.5 W at 24Vdc. It can operate in ambient air temperatures ranging from -40 to +65 °C and can be stored in temperatures from -45 to +85 °C. The device includes 1 x digital output (relay NO contact; 24Vac/1A max. / 24Vdc/1A max.), 4 x analog inputs (2 x 0-10Vdc / 0-20mA / Pt100 16-bit and 2 x 0-10Vdc / 0-20mA), and 2 x digital inputs (dry contact type), with Ethernet speeds of 10/100Mbit/s.

Anybus by HMS Networks AB7001-C is a gateway designed for serial communication, belonging to the Serial Communicators sub-range. This gateway supports configurable RS-232/422/485 protocols for produce/consume and query/response ASCII communications, accommodating up to 31 stations with RS485/422 and offering a baud rate range of 1.2-57.6kbit/s. It is compatible with various Modbus commands and DF1 services, including reading and writing coils, registers, diagnostics, and data integrity checks. The device features reverse voltage protection, short circuit protection, and galvanic isolation on the sub-network, with an MTTF of over 550,000 hours. Designed for industrial environments, it has immunity to electrostatic discharge, electromagnetic RF fields, fast transients, surge protection, and RF conducted interference, with specific emission levels. The AB7001-C has a plastic housing (ABS/PC), measures H120mm x W27mm x D75mm, and includes a 5-pin plug-in connector for DeviceNet, a 9-pin D-sub female connector for serial communication, a 2-poles plug-in connector for power, and an RJ11 PC connector. It supports a supply voltage of 21.6-26.4Vdc (24Vdc nominal), operates within an ambient air temperature range of 0 to +55 °C, and consumes a maximum of 300mA at 24Vdc. The device is designed for DIN rail mounting, offers an IP20 and NEMA 1 degree of protection, and is suitable for use in environments with up to 95% relative humidity, non-condensing.

Ixxat by HMS Networks 1.01.0068.46010 is a repeater designed for converting signals from ISO 11898-2 to fiber optic cable and vice versa. It features a stackable converter/repeater functionality with a Texas Instruments SN65HVD251 CAN transceiver. This part supports a maximum of 120 bus nodes and includes a 120Ω CAN bus termination resistor, which is switchable via a DIP switch. The CAN bus interface complies with ISO 11898-2 standards and utilizes a Sub-D9 connector with integrated, switchable CAN termination resistors. For fiber optic connections, it offers 2 x F-SMA or ST terminals suitable for duplex lines with multi-mode glass of 50/125μm or 62.5/125μm. The repeater introduces a delay of 300ns, equivalent to a 60m bus length, not accounting for the fiber optic signal delay time of 5ns/m. It provides galvanic isolation of 1kV and features a design with 1 x T-bus connector, 1 x ST connector for fiber optics, and 1 x 4-poles plug-in screw connector for power. The device operates with a control voltage of 1.5W (typical), can withstand ambient air temperatures for storage from -20 to +70°C, and operates within a humidity range of 10-95% RH non-condensing. It is housed in a plastic (ABS) enclosure suitable for DIN rail mounting, measuring 100mm in height, 22.5mm in width, and 120mm in depth, and offers protection up to IP30. The repeater is designed to support communication speeds up to 1Mbit/s (CAN).

Ewon by HMS Networks Flexy20200_00MA is a gateway belonging to the Flexy 200 series, designed for industrial remote data collection and routing. It features routing capabilities between LAN and WAN, Ethernet interface, and Ethernet to serial gateway, supporting a wide range of protocols including MODBUS TCP/RTU, XIP to UNITELWAY, EtherNet/IP to DF1, and more. The device is capable of data acquisition through protocols such as OPC UA, MODBUS/RTU, and others, storing up to 2500 internal tags. It supports data publishing via OPC UA, Modbus, MQTT, among others, and offers alarm notifications through email, SMS, or SNMP traps with four threshold levels. The Flexy20200_00MA includes an internal database for real-time and historical data logging, with an SD card reader for commissioning and extended user memory. Its router functions include IP filtering, NAT, and VPN tunnelling with SSL/TLS encryption for secure communication. Programmable in Basic and Java 2 Standard Edition, it also features synchronization through an embedded real-time clock, file management via FTP, and an embedded web interface for configuration. The design includes an LED indicator, dimensions of H80mm x W134mm x D89mm, and connections via RJ45 and 9-pin D-sub male connectors, with two SD card connectors. It supports a variety of communication protocols, operates on a supply voltage of 9.6-28.8Vdc, and is designed for DIN rail mounting. The operating temperature range is -25 to +60 °C, with storage temperatures from -30 to +70 °C, and it can handle 10-95% relative humidity (non-condensing).

Bridges

A bridge is a networking device that connects two separate networks and allows them to communicate with each other. It operates at the data link layer of the network and helps in directing network traffic between different segments.

Hubs

A hub is a simple networking device that connects multiple devices within a network. It operates at the physical layer of the network and works as a central point for data transmission, allowing devices to share information.

NICs (Network Interface Cards)

NICs, also known as network interface cards, are hardware devices that enable computers to connect to a network. They are responsible for translating data into a format that can be transmitted over the network and receiving data from the network.

Modems

A modem is a device that converts digital signals from a computer into analog signals that can be transmitted over telephone lines or cable lines. It is used to establish a connection to the internet or other remote networks.

Repeaters

A repeater is a networking device that regenerates and amplifies signals to extend the reach of a network. It receives signals, cleans them, and boosts their strength before transmitting them to another part of the network.

Switches

A switch is a networking device that connects multiple devices within a network and forwards data packets between them. It operates at the data link layer and improves network efficiency by transmitting data only to the intended recipient.

Routers

Routers are devices that connect different networks and facilitate the transfer of data between them. They operate at the network layer and use routing tables to determine the best path for data transmission.

Firewalls

A firewall is a security device that protects a network from unauthorized access and potential threats. It monitors incoming and outgoing network traffic and applies security rules to prevent malicious activities.

Gateways

A gateway is a networking device that connects two different types of networks, such as a local area network (LAN) and the internet. It acts as an intermediary and enables seamless communication between the networks.
